Kris has two choices for a part-time job after school. Kris could make 10 per hour entering data for a local company, but none of his friends work there. The second job offer pays 8 per hour at a local restaurant, and many of his friends work there. If Kris works 20 hours per week, what would be the weekly opportunity cost of accepting the job at the restaurant? 120 40 20 160
